Warning Signs You Need Thermal Imaging Leak Detection

Water damage can be sneaky, but there are often warning signs that show a problem is brewing. Catching these signs early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ent bigger problems down the line.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Unpleasant odors in your home can be a sign of hidden water damage. If you notice a persistent musty smell, it’s time to call in the professionals.

Water Stains on Ceilings and Walls

Thermal Imaging Leak Detection Cost In Argyle, TX

The cost of Thermal Imaging Leak Detection in Argyle, TX can vary depending on the severity and size of the affected area. Our prices range from $500 to $2,500, depending on the scope of the project. Factors that affect the cost include the size of the affected area, the type of materials damaged, and the complexity of the repair.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Initial Inspection and Assessment $100 – $500 Size and complexity of the affected area
Leak Detection and Repair $500 – $2,500 Size and type of materials damaged
Water Damage Repair and Restoration $1,000 – $5,000 Size and complexity of the affected area
Mold Remediation $500 – $2,000 Size and type of mold affected
Dehumidification and Drying $100 – $500 Size and complexity of the affected area
Final Inspection and Verification $100 – $500 Size and complexity of the affected area
